Technical Specifications

  • Voltage20 V
  • Torque115 in-lbs
  • rpm650 rpm
  • Clutch Settings11
  • Power SourceLithium Ion
  • Chuck Size3/8 "

I bought the drill from Lowe's with a military discount, paid $62.00. I work on a motorcycle trailer with no electricity at my storage area. This drill screwed in over 200 screws, drilled at least 150 pilot holes (over 100 through steel) and never showed signs of fatigue.
